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ities at Sawbridgeworth Train Station

The station is well-equipped to handle the needs of passengers. You can purchase tickets from the ticket office, open from early in the morning to mid-afternoon on weekdays and slightly longer on weekends. For those in a hurry, accessible 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online quickly. The station is accommodating for customers who need assistance, with help available from friendly staff during the listed hours and customer help points scattered throughout the station. While the station does not provide luggage storage services or CCTV, passengers can rest assured that smartcard validators and induction loops enhance both convenience and accessibility.

Though there are no on-site refreshment facilities or shops, passengers can enjoy the public Wi-Fi, perfect for catching up on work or planning the rest of their journey. If you're biking to the station, you'll find ample bike storage options with stands and racks, some of which are even sheltered under CCTV surveillance. However, there are no facilities for bicycle hire, so plan accordingly if you're hitting the trails beyond Sawbridgeworth.

Onward Travel Options

Sawbridgeworth Train Station serves as a nodal point for easy onward travel, seamlessly linking you with various transportation modes. For those needing to continue their journey by bus, you'll be glad to know that Sawbridgeworth is a PlusBus location, providing excellent connectivity to the local area. For seamless rail replacements, services operate from Cambridge Road bus stops. However, please be aware that no taxi ranks or car hire services are directly accessed from the station, so these should be prearranged if needed.

Ease of Access

Though the station provides step-free access to both platforms via Station Road level crossing, it is recommended to reach out for assistance two hours in advance to ensure a seamless experience, especially for travelers with impaired mobility. Facilities and Amenities

Burgess Hill Station boasts a variety of facilities to accommodate passenger needs. The ticket office is open from the early morning hours until the evening on weekdays and weekends, making it convenient to pur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and accessible. These machines accommodate discounted fares for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While waiting rooms may be absent, there is a seating area available to ensure your comfort as you await departure.

Travelers seeking support will find ample staff availability throughout the day. Whether you need information or assistance, helpful staff members are at hand.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, and there are help points on the platforms for additional assistance. It's important to note that while there is step-free access to the platforms, it is via long and steep ramps. Additionally, facilities such as accessible toilets or waiting rooms are not present.

Transport Links for a Seamless Journey

Your journey doesn't end at Burgess Hill Station. The station provides various onward travel options to keep you connected. For local mobility, you can easily find a taxi service stationed right outside the main entrance. In case of rail disruptions, a rail replacement bus service is available. Travelers looking to continue their journey via bus can access information through the Onward Travel Information Map provided at the station.
